Dental implants have become a preferred choice for people in search of to switch missing teeth. However, a concern that usually arises is whether these implants could cause sinus problems. Understanding the anatomy of the mouth and the sinuses can make clear this issue, as properly as the varied elements that contribute to such complications.
When dental implants are positioned in the higher jaw, they might come into shut proximity to the maxillary sinuses. These sinuses are positioned above the upper teeth and may be affected during the implant procedure. The course of usually entails drilling into the jawbone to insert the titanium publish that may function the dental implant root. If this isn't carried out with precision, it’s attainable for the implant to protrude into the sinus cavity.


One major factor that can contribute to sinus complications is the health of the jawbone. If there may be significant bone loss within the space the place the implant is being positioned, the surgeon could need to conduct a bone graft. This can increase the risk of complications, including potential issues with the maxillary sinuses, because the graft material may penetrate the sinus area.


Even if the bone is deemed sufficient for the implant, there can nonetheless be risks related to surgery. The insertion of an implant creates a minor surgical wound. As with any surgical process, there's a risk of infection. If an infection happens within the area surrounding a dental implant, it could doubtlessly unfold to the sinus cavity, leading to sinusitis or other problems.

Some patients may also expertise sinus-related signs post-surgery that mimic sinusitis but are not because of an actual infection. This condition is known as post-operative sinusitis. Symptoms might include nasal congestion, facial pain, or pressure. The discomfort is likely related to irritation or irritation in the tissues of the sinus, somewhat than an precise infection.


To mitigate the risks of sinus complications throughout dental implant surgery, a radical pre-operative assessment is crucial. Dentists sometimes use imaging methods, such as CT scans, to evaluate the relationship between the higher jaw and the maxillary sinuses. This helps in determining the exact placement of the implants with out invading the sinus space.


Another significant consideration is the experience and talent of the dental surgeon performing the implant. A qualified and experienced practitioner is much less likely to lead to problems. Advanced coaching in dental surgery reinforces methods that may decrease risks associated with sinus problems.
